CHAPTER 1 AN INTRODUCTION TO REALBASIC REALbasic (Disney web site)

CHAPTER 1 AN INTRODUCTION TO REALBASIC REALbasic vs. Apple s XCode Just as REALbasic competes with Microsoft s Visual Basic as a tool for application development for Windows software, REALbasic also has plenty of competition in the Apple world. One competitor of particular significance is Apple s XCode. Like REALbasic, XCode is a tool suite and an IDE for software creation on the Mac OS X. There is no doubt that XCode provides an effective and powerful software development platform. Programmers with a strong Macintosh background no doubt will want to give it serious consideration. However, unlike REALbasic, XCode s capabilities are strictly limited to Mac OS X development. Unlike REALbasic, XCode is not designed to support the development of applications on previous versions of the MAC OS. XCode s focus is on providing a powerful software development environment that facilitates application development using any of an assortment of programming languages. XCode is also designed to provide programmers with access to the latest Apple technologies. The programming languages supported by XCode include C C++ Objective-C Java AppleScript XCode provides a powerful and robust IDE for the development of software designed specifically for the Max OS X. However, it falls short of REALbasic in many ways. For example, while REALbasic is based on a easy to learn, yet powerful, implementation of BASIC, XCode only supports AppleScript, Java, and variations of C and C++. XCode also falls short in the area of cross-platform development. Programmers who develop an application using XCode and one of its supported version of C or C++ must be prepared to rewrite their applications to port them over to Windows or Linux. While versions of C and C++ exist on both Windows and Linux, the programmer needs to be prepared to deal with differences in the way the languages are implemented on other platforms. In addition, the programmer also must be prepared to learn to work with different IDEs on each platform to which the application will be ported.
If you are in need for chaep and reliable webhost to host your website, our recommendation is http web server services.

Leave a Reply